Transaction 3738b84af981f07f4e7f0f64be94e8c66e180920c0f50f99943a2ae0a0db9373

1 Input
2 Outputs
  • 3738b84af981f07f4e7f0f64be94e8c66e180920c0f50f99943a2ae0a0db9373:0
  • value  7885472093
    address  2NBDgxEFd9HfbcPk92hm6J8vE2kk3Wa4QFM
  • 3738b84af981f07f4e7f0f64be94e8c66e180920c0f50f99943a2ae0a0db9373:1
  • value  2681316
    address  2NBM3YRMSaTzvpBHkC7LSPNbm8WkPAUHYJd